Road Roller Manufacturer: What Work Environments Are Small Road Rollers Suitable For?

1. The hand‑operated small roller is suitable for layering cement‑stabilized base courses during road and municipal maintenance and paving operations, as well as for compacting asphalt concrete in well areas and corners.

2. It can operate in confined spaces. During road construction, when backfilling pipe culverts, passages, and bridge abutments, large rollers cannot function effectively during compaction.

3. Suitable for municipal and landscape gardening, residential community landscaping, golf course development, and pedestrian‑area compaction.

4. The Luoyang road roller is extremely powerful and boasts excellent quality. In compacting operations within relatively confined construction areas, it offers exceptional sensitivity and remarkable maneuverability.

5. Hand‑operated small rollers are suitable for compacting sand and asphalt; selecting the right model can accelerate project progress and deliver superior compaction performance.

Road Roller Manufacturer: Pre-Startup Preparations for Road Rollers in Luoyang

Operating a small walk-behind road roller is not difficult; with proper handling, it’s relatively easy to learn. Today, the road roller manufacturer will show you what to do before starting the machine.

1. Before starting the road roller, carefully inspect that all fasteners are securely tightened and that all attachments are intact.

2. Check the oil level in the oil pan and the fuel injection pump; it should be between the upper and lower marks on the dipstick.

3. Check the fuel tank’s fuel storage capacity. Open the fuel tank valve to allow diesel to flow into the fuel injection pump, thereby bleeding air from the fuel system.

4. Check the battery and connections. Please verify the electrolyte level inside the battery.

5. Inspect the cooling system and add sufficient coolant.

6. In cold and freezing climates, the diesel engine should be stored in a freeze‑proof cabinet. When operating in the field, preheat the oil pan before starting, then flush it with hot water two or three times to warm up the engine.

7. During diesel engine start-up, the clutch shall be in the disengaged position.

Small rollers are also known as walk-behind rollers. Currently, domestically produced small rollers fall into three main types: walk-behind single-drum rollers and handheld double-drum rollers. These machines are powered by either diesel or gasoline engines. When selecting a roller, consider the material being compacted: for cohesive materials, use a static drum; for static‑pressure rollers, opt for a three‑drum model when compacting subgrades and a two‑drum model when working on pavement surfaces.

Rammer rollers are well suited for compacting cohesive soils and make excellent equipment for constructing dam core layers, but they are not ideal for surface compaction. For non-cohesive materials, Luoyang Agricultural Machinery recommends using vibratory rollers. When the soil has low moisture content and is difficult to moisten with water, a heavy‑duty roller should be selected. Conversely, when the material is highly moist and has a low dry unit weight, a light‑weight roller is the appropriate choice.

Tire rollers are suitable for a wide range of crushed materials and deliver excellent compaction performance on asphalt pavements. Small rollers are ideal for minor projects and confined spaces—such as municipal road rehabilitation, rural road upgrades, landscaping and bridge construction, and residential access roads—as well as for trench backfilling or as supplementary compactors in large‑scale paving operations. In practice, a single type of roller often cannot meet the compaction requirements of an entire project; instead, it is typically necessary to combine large, medium, and small models or employ multiple configurations. Therefore, when selecting rollers, factors such as the nature of the project, its scale, and the allowable duration of compaction work must be carefully considered. Ultimately, an economically sound choice should be made through comprehensive analysis and careful comparison across all relevant criteria.

The basic configuration of a small road roller primarily comprises an engine, a hydraulic system, steel wheels, a vibrator, and an operator’s handle. Engines are available in diesel and gasoline versions. At present, small road rollers in China can be classified into three types: walk-behind single‑drum rollers, walk-behind double‑drum rollers, and mounted rollers.
